#022933 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#022933 is composed of 0.8% red, 16.1%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.1% cyan, 19.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 80% black. It has a hue angle of 192.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 10.4%. #022933 color hex could be obtained by blending #045266 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

● #022933 color description : Very dark cyan.
#022933 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#022933 has RGB values of R:2, G:41,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 141619.
